Understanding Executive CV Writing in London: What Actually Drives Decisions

Short answer: Executive CVs in London are evaluated through leadership clarity, commercial accountability, and strategic contribution rather than chronological job history.

In practice, hiring committees in London do not read executive CVs line by line. They scan for signals: scale of responsibility, transformation outcomes, and governance exposure. A CV that fails to communicate these quickly is often discarded before interview consideration.

Example: A Managing Director candidate reduced a 5-page CV into 2.5 pages focused only on revenue influence, restructuring outcomes, and board interaction. Interview rate increased from 11% to 38% within two months.

CV ElementWeak ApproachEffective Executive Approach
ExperienceTask-based descriptionsStrategic leadership outcomes
AchievementsGeneric success claimsQuantified business impact
StructureChronological listingImpact-led hierarchy
LanguageOperational detailBoard-level decision framing

Many professionals underestimate how quickly decision-makers evaluate executive profiles. In London recruitment cycles, especially in finance, consulting, and tech leadership, CVs are often screened in under a minute before shortlisting decisions are made.

Board-Level vs Senior Executive CVs: What Changes at Higher Levels

Short answer: Board-level CVs emphasize governance, risk oversight, and strategic direction, while senior executive CVs focus on operational leadership and transformation.

DimensionSenior ExecutiveBoard-Level
FocusExecution & leadership deliveryGovernance & oversight
Impact framingDepartment or function resultsOrganisational or portfolio outcomes
Language styleOperational strategyStrategic governance
Decision scopeFunctional authorityEnterprise-level influence

In London board recruitment, especially within FTSE-listed companies, committees look for evidence of risk management exposure, regulatory awareness, and stakeholder management at scale.

Common Mistakes in Executive CV Writing

Short answer: Most executive CVs fail due to vague leadership claims, lack of measurable outcomes, and over-focus on operational detail.

Frequent Errors Observed in London Hiring Cycles

Anti-Pattern Example:
“Responsible for leading large teams and improving performance.”

This statement lacks measurable outcomes, scale, and context.

How Recruiters in London Actually Scan Executive CVs

Short answer: Recruiters use rapid scanning patterns focusing on titles, scale, achievements, and leadership keywords.

Eye-tracking studies in recruitment environments show that hiring managers focus on:

Scan ElementTime SpentDecision Impact
Headline role2–4 secondsHigh
Executive summary10–20 secondsVery high
Achievements section15–30 secondsHigh
Full career historyRarely fully readMedium

London recruitment agencies report that over 60% of executive CVs are rejected due to unclear leadership positioning within the first scan phase.

Template: Executive Achievement Statement

“Led [function/team] across [scope], delivering [measurable outcome] through [strategic action], resulting in [business impact].”

5 Practical Improvement Tips from Executive CV Specialists

  1. Start every role with business impact, not responsibilities.
  2. Reduce historical detail that does not support leadership narrative.
  3. Quantify outcomes wherever possible.
  4. Align tone with board-level expectations.
  5. Ensure consistency across CV and professional profiles.

FAQ: Executive CV Writing London UK

1. What makes an executive CV different from a standard CV?

It focuses on leadership impact, governance exposure, and strategic outcomes rather than task-based experience.

2. How long should an executive CV be in the UK?

Typically 2–3 pages, depending on seniority and board exposure.

3. Do London recruiters read full executive CVs?

Most only scan key sections within the first minute before deciding.

4. What is most important in a board-level CV?

Governance experience, strategic decisions, and measurable organisational impact.

5. Should I include all job responsibilities?

No, only those that demonstrate leadership outcomes and business impact.

6. How do I show leadership impact effectively?

By quantifying results and linking actions to business change.

7. What is the biggest mistake executives make?

Listing responsibilities instead of demonstrating outcomes.

8. Do I need a different CV for each role?

Yes, tailoring leadership positioning improves relevance significantly.

9. How important is formatting?

Very important; clarity and readability influence first impressions.

10. What industries require stronger CV structure?

Finance, consulting, tech leadership, and regulated industries.

11. How can I improve my executive summary?

Focus on leadership identity, scale, and measurable outcomes.

12. Can I transition from senior management to board roles?

Yes, with clear governance and strategic framing.

13. Should I include metrics?

Yes, metrics significantly increase credibility.

14. How often should I update my CV?

Every 6–12 months or after major achievements.
